Nationwide has good claims processing and customer service
I've been with Nationwide for a few years now, and have used other Pet Insurers in the past. All-in-all, they've been pretty good about processing any claims I submit vs. other providers. The reason I haven't given them a better rating is that there's been a couple claims that have been denied and the online claim filing is almost non-existent. It's either by email and attaching a claim form, or through the 'VitaVet' app. Considering everything and my past experiences with other companies, Nationwide's prices, I'd say they do a good job and are fair overall. I'd recommend them.

I am able to focus on my two dogs' health - instead of worrying about bills
I am thankful each and every time something comes up with our two dogs that I’m not put into a position where we have to make some horribly tough decision, like so many people … Do I move forward with this expensive procedure and have to sell my car? Not eat for a few months? Fall into an insurmountable load of credit card debt? Or worse, for some people, because they cannot afford it, they end up having to put off a needed procedure while their pet suffers each day, because surgery is just not a financial option for them. What a horrible conversation people have to have. Healthy Paws covered TWO TPLO surgeries for one of my dogs - at 90%. In addition, they covered holistic underwater physical therapy for months at 90% each visit. My dog, years later, grew an abscess in one leg, and had to have ALL the metal in both legs removed. Healthy Paws covered this procedure at 90% as well. We would do anything for our dog, which means, we would have done the surgeries without insurance. But we would be in at LEAST about $20,000 worth of credit card debt right now, just for the TPLO issues alone, without our Healthy Paws coverage. Every time I call, their customer service representatives are kind and compassionate. They have recently raised our rates. However, I know people with other pet insurance who also had their rates increased. (I think inflation is just making everything more expensive across the board.) Healthy Paws does NOT cover: ~ Vaccines ~ Office visit charges ~ PRE-EXISTING CONDITIONS I am truly thankful we made the decision to go with Healthy Paws. - Gretchen P. Emeryville, CA
